A little miniature Avoca style artisan cafe, small interior with a friendly comfortable feel to it. Lovely wooden chairs and tables and menus on blackboards written in chalk. A quick flick through the menu. Some real tempting specials of the week but seeing as we were there for breakfast we couldn't really go for the steak ciabatta sandwich or as Mr.C would have preferred, fusilli pasta with rocket and sun dried tomatoes.
There was a really nice selection for breakfast. We both opted for the GFP Big Breakfast-
The GFP big breakfast – smoked bacon, Cumberland sausage, Clonakilty black and white pudding
served with our creamy scrambled eggs with chives, tomato relish and toast €8.95 .....
And tea for two.
The scrambled eggs really were creamy and yum. The portions were huge! I had trouble finishing it but Mr.C gladly ate all of his. True to the name it really was a big breakfast, however there wasn't any of that greasy feeling to any bite of it.
